Where do I even start with Taylor and Charley’s wedding? There were so many incredible, personalized details, each one reflecting their unique story. It’s hard to choose just a few highlights when every part of the day was so thoughtfully crafted and so them. But let’s dive in!

 

I’ll kick things off with the stationery that was beautifully executed by Aryn Graves. From the very first meeting, it was clear that Taylor had a vision for the wedding that was deeply personal. She’s an incredible writer—if I remember correctly, she even wrote articles for her school newsletter. Her passion for the written word was evident, and I knew stationery would play a huge role in their celebration. As we sat in my office, Charley said “Paper is everything. It’s where I write my songs. I use hotel notepads to jot down lyrics.” It was such a beautiful moment, understanding how meaningful every piece of paper would be for both of them. From the invitations to the thank-you notes, every detail of the stationery was a true reflection of Charley and Taylor—thoughtful, intentional, and full of heart.

 

Now, let’s talk flowers. Remi and Gold brought Taylor’s floral vision to life in the most stunning way. She had this one photo on her phone of the colors that caught her eye, and from that single image, the entire wedding’s floral aesthetic was born. The Remi and Gold team went above and beyond, creating arrangements that were nothing short of breathtaking. The venue itself was transformed with the whimsical draping from Unique Designs and Events and dreamy twinkle lights by Ilios Lighting.

 

And the food. Oh, the food. The tasting was hands down one of my all-time favorites. Contigo Catering truly outdid themselves, bringing flavor and elegance to every plate. The meal was a delicious masterpiece, perfectly complementing the atmosphere of the day.

 

But let’s talk about the highlight of the wedding, one of the most thrilling projects I’ve ever been a part of—the carnival rides. What started as Taylor’s dream of having a Ferris wheel quickly evolved into something beyond our wildest imaginations. We added a carousel (Charley’s favorite), and the result was absolutely magical. To see these two beloved rides come to life at Willie Nelson’s ranch—well, it was a pinch-me moment. Without a doubt, it was one of the most exciting and memorable parts of my career.
